The value of k such that the lines 2x-3y+k=0,3x-4y-13=0 and 8x-11y-33=0 are concurrent is

Solution

The correct option is B

-7


Explanation for the correct option:

In the question, it is given that the line 2x-3y+k=0,3x-4y-13=0 and 8x-11y-33=0 are concurrent.

So, the condition for lines to be concurrent is a1b1c1a2b2c2a3b3c3=0.

So,

2-3k3-4-138-11-33=0

Expand the determinant with respect to R1.

2(132-143)+3(-99+104)+k(-33+32)=0-22+15-k=0k=-7

Therefore, the required value of k is -7.

Hence, option B is the correct answer.
